  • The Butler Bulldogs beat the Independence Patriots for the first time in seven years about a week ago.  It was the first loss for Independence to a North Carolina school in the same time.  It was the Bulldogs first outright conference championship and first #2 seed in the playoffs.  They’ll play again this Friday night in the 2nd round of the state playoffs at Memorial Stadium, with an expected attendance around 15 to 20 thousand.
